Key Techniques for Effective Garden Bed Preservation

  • Soil Health: Maintaining healthy soil is paramount. Regularly testing soil pH and nutrient levels can help you understand what amendments are necessary. Adding organic matter, such as compost, can enhance soil structure and fertility.
  • Mulching: Applying a layer of mulch not only conserves moisture but also suppresses weeds. Organic mulches, like wood chips or straw, break down over time, enriching the soil.
  • Crop Rotation: Rotating crops each season helps prevent soil depletion and reduces the risk of pests and diseases. This practice encourages biodiversity and improves soil health.
  • Pest Management: Integrated Pest Management (IPM) strategies can minimize damage from pests. This includes using beneficial insects, companion planting, and organic pesticides when necessary.

Seasonal Maintenance for Garden Bed Preservation

Seasonal changes can significantly impact your garden beds. During spring, it is essential to prepare the soil by tilling and adding nutrients. In summer, regular watering and weeding are crucial to prevent stress on plants. As autumn approaches, consider planting cover crops to protect the soil during winter months. This proactive approach ensures that your garden beds remain healthy and productive.
